Justin Costello, who posed as a billionaire and 2 times-wounded Exclusive Forces Iraq veteran to dupe investors whilst portraying himself as a legal hashish mogul, pleaded guilty Wednesday to securities fraud.

Underneath a plea agreement with Costello, prosecutors will advise a sentence of 10 a long time in prison for him. Costello also agreed to fork out victims of his frauds not significantly less than $35 million in restitution.

Costello’s guilty plea in federal courtroom in Seattle, arrived three months immediately after an FBI SWAT team apprehended the 42-12 months-old in a remote place of southern California, carrying a backpack made up of gold bars, $70,000 in U.S. and Mexican currency, and a phony ID.

Times earlier, he had failed to surrender as agreed to experience an indcitment in the case.

Costello’s sentencing was scheduled for April 21.

He has been held devoid of bail considering that his arrest.
